Italian Beef Soup with Pasta Shells

Ingredients

Scale

3 pounds beef chuck roast
1 quart beef stock
5 cups hot water
1 large onion, quartered
3 celery stalks with leaves, cut into 1-inch pieces
1 pound carrots, peeled and halved horizontally
2 tablespoons fresh parsley, stems removed
2 cloves garlic, smashed
1 teaspoon salt
1/2 teaspoon black pepper
8 ounces small pasta shells


Instructions

Place the beef chuck roast in a large pot and add the beef stock and hot water until the meat is three-quarters submerged.
Bring the liquid to a gentle boil, then skim off any foam that rises to the surface.
Add the onion, celery, carrots, parsley, garlic, salt, and pepper to the pot.
Cover and simmer over low heat for 3 to 4 hours, or until the beef is fork-tender.
Remove the beef from the pot, shred it into bite-sized pieces, and set aside.
Strain the broth to remove the cooked vegetables and herbs, then return the clear broth to the pot.
Bring the broth back to a boil and add the pasta shells; cook according to package instructions until al dente.
Stir the shredded beef back into the soup and heat through before serving.


Notes

Ensure you do not overfill the pot; leave enough room for the soup to simmer without bubbling over.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. If the soup thickens too much upon reheating, add a splash of water or beef stock.
